IBM Support

PH15075: MESSAGE DFHMQ0710E MISSING WHEN ISSUED FROM TRANSACTION CKBR

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Whilst stress testing our DPL bridge we were getting a number of
    error messages for transaction CKBR.
    These were a pair of messages:
    DFHMQ0760I and DFHMQ0762I and CICS Info Centre points you at a
    preceding message which should be  DFHMQ0710E.
    
    But basically in the dump I can see several
    
    AP A0B5 MQTRU *EXC* - CSQCCCRC - MQCC(00000002) MQRC(000007F1)
    
    Then I can see messages DFHMQ760I and DFHMQ0762I being issued .
    But I do not see DFHMQ0710E message with MQRC=2033.
    

Local fix

  • NA
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All CICS users.                              *
    ****************************************************************
    * PROBLEM DESCRIPTION: Missing error message as a result of    *
    *                      setting ROUTEMEM=Y and the mark browse  *
    *                      interval expiring which results in the  *
    *                      following messages DFHMQ0760 and        *
    *                      DFHMQ0762 being issued.                 *
    ****************************************************************
    When running the CICS MQ Bridge with option ROUTEMEM=Y under
    load it can happen that a marked message interval will expire
    resulting in the message again becoming available to the CKBR
    transaction. In this case, because the message has already been,
     processed it is removed from the input MQ queue and the
    messages DFHMQ0760 and DFHMQ0762  are issued.
    The message text of the above messages refer to a previous
    message, but this was never issued.
    

Problem conclusion

  • New message DFHMQ0795I has been created that describes this
    condition.
    
    The CICS Transaction Server Version 5 Release 4 and Version 5
    Release 5, CICS Messages manual will be updated as follows.
    In Chapter 2. DFHMQnnnn messages - a new
    message will be added immediately after the description of
    message DFHMQ0793I. This new message description will read as
    below.
    
    DFHMQ0795 E date time applid tranid trannum The CICS-MQ bridge
    has retrieved a message which has been previously marked and the
    mark browse interval has expired.
    
    Explanation: The CICS-MQ bridge is running with ROUTEMEM=Y and
    retrieved a message which has been previously marked and the
    mark browse interval has expired without the message having
    been processed. The transaction that should have processed the
    message could have been delayed for a period that exceeds the
    mark browse interval.
    
    System action: The message is removed from the bridge queue.
    
    User response: Check for associated messages to determine if the
    message was returned to the bridge queue or moved to another
    queue. Investigate potential transaction delays.
    
    Module: DFHMQBR0
    
    XMEOUT Parameters: date, time,applid, tranid, trannum
    
    Destination: Console and Transient Data Queue CMQM and Terminal
    

Temporary fix

Comments

APAR Information

  • APAR number

    PH15075

  • Reported component name

    CICS TS Z/OS V5

  • Reported component ID

    5655Y0400

  • Reported release

    100

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2019-07-30

  • Closed date

    2019-08-20

  • Last modified date

    2019-09-01

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I64851 UI64852 UI64853

Modules/Macros

  • DFHMEMQC DFHMEMQE DFHMEMQK DFHMQP0@ DFHMQP1@ DFHMQP3@ DFHMQR0@
    

Fix information

  • Fixed component name

    CICS TS Z/OS V5

  • Fixed component ID

    5655Y0400

Applicable component levels

  • R100 PSY UI64851

       UP19/08/23 P F908

  • R103 PSY UI64852

       UP19/08/23 P F908

  • R200 PSY UI64853

       UP19/08/21 P F908

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.4","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.4","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
01 September 2019